Introduction
The aircraft pumps market is projected to expand from USD 3.5 billion in 2023 to USD 4.76 billion by 2030, exhibiting a compound annual growth rate (CAGR) of 4.5% during this period. This growth is attributed to several factors, including an uptick in aircraft fleet renewal and the burgeoning demand for more agile, lightweight aircraft equipped with advanced, compact pumping systems.
Aircraft pumps are indispensable components that facilitate critical functions such as fuel transfer, lubrication, and hydraulic power generation, thereby ensuring aircraft systems' safe and efficient operation. By supplying fuel to engines, maintaining hydraulic pressure for flight controls, and circulating lubricants to essential engine components, these pumps play a pivotal role in enhancing overall aircraft performance, safety, and functionality.
Contemporary market trends underscore a growing emphasis on lightweight, compact pump designs to optimize fuel efficiency, coupled with the integration of intelligent sensors for real-time performance monitoring. Original equipment manufacturers (OEMs) are actively engaged in research and development to leverage advanced materials and additive manufacturing techniques for pump design optimization. Industry leaders such as Honeywell International Inc., Parker Hannifin Corporation, and Eaton Corporation are at the forefront of this dynamic market, driving innovation to meet the aviation industry's stringent requirements for enhanced efficiency, reliability, and sustainability in aircraft pumping systems.

Recent Market JVs and Acquisitions:
Strategic Alliances including M&As, JVs, etc. have been performed over the past few years:
- In July 2023, Eaton and Singapore Airlines Engineering Company Limited formed a joint venture in Malaysia for the maintenance, repair, and overhaul of Eaton-manufactured aircraft components, predominantly focusing on fuel and hydraulic systems.
- In May 2023, Parker Aerospace, a division of Parker Hannifin Corporation, secured a substantial five-year contract from the U.S. Army to overhaul and upgrade hydraulic pump and flight control actuation systems for the UH-60 Black Hawk helicopter.
- In January 2023, Triumph Group's Actuation Products and Services division obtained a contract to supply control cables for Airbus A220 emergency exit doors, leveraging its expertise in electro-hydraulic and mechanical systems.
- In June 2021, Eaton enhanced its aerospace capabilities through the acquisition of Cobham Mission Systems, expanding its product range to include air-to-air refueling, environmental systems, and actuation components.
